Egeplast Ege Plastik Ticaret ve Sanayi AS (EPLAS) has a Net Asset Quality Index of 71.7% as of June 2024. This metric measures the proportion of total assets financed by shareholders' equity — total assets of TL3.26 Billion minus total liabilities of TL921.98 Million yields net assets of TL2.33 Billion. A higher index indicates a stronger, lower-leverage balance sheet. Annual Net Asset Quality Index for Egeplast Ege Plastik Ticaret ve Sanayi AS (2005–2023)
The table below presents the year-by-year Net Asset Quality Index for Egeplast Ege Plastik Ticaret ve Sanayi AS from 2005 to 2023, covering 19 annual filings. Each row shows total assets, total liabilities, net assets, the quality index percentage, and the change in percentage points compared to the prior year. | Year | Quality Index | Net Assets (TRY) | Total Assets | Total Liabilities | Change (pp) |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2023 | 75.8% | TL2.00 Billion | TL2.64 Billion | TL639.74 Million | ▲ +7.7 pp |
| 2022 | 68.1% | TL988.26 Million | TL1.45 Billion | TL463.25 Million | ▲ +44.2 pp |
| 2021 | 23.9% | TL104.02 Million | TL435.23 Million | TL331.21 Million | ▼ -28.5 pp |
| 2020 | 52.4% | TL145.86 Million | TL278.41 Million | TL132.55 Million | ▲ +13.2 pp |
| 2019 | 39.2% | TL64.17 Million | TL163.86 Million | TL99.69 Million | ▲ +2.9 pp |
| 2018 | 36.3% | TL57.37 Million | TL158.22 Million | TL100.84 Million | ▲ +29.0 pp |
| 2017 | 7.2% | TL10.83 Million | TL149.66 Million | TL138.83 Million | ▲ +17.9 pp |
| 2016 | -10.6% | TL-12.83 Million | TL120.77 Million | TL133.60 Million | ▲ +15.0 pp |
| 2015 | -25.6% | TL-23.98 Million | TL93.62 Million | TL117.60 Million | ▼ -37.9 pp |
| 2014 | 12.3% | TL10.70 Million | TL87.10 Million | TL76.40 Million | ▲ +11.5 pp |
| 2013 | 0.7% | TL723.40K | TL97.22 Million | TL96.50 Million | ▲ +37.4 pp |
| 2012 | -36.6% | TL-33.21 Million | TL90.67 Million | TL123.88 Million | ▼ -2.4 pp |
| 2011 | -34.3% | TL-30.86 Million | TL90.06 Million | TL120.92 Million | ▼ -7.9 pp |
| 2010 | -26.4% | TL-21.33 Million | TL80.78 Million | TL102.11 Million | ▼ -1.8 pp |
| 2009 | -24.6% | TL-20.77 Million | TL84.54 Million | TL105.31 Million | ▲ +9.8 pp |
| 2008 | -34.3% | TL-28.47 Million | TL82.92 Million | TL111.39 Million | ▼ -25.6 pp |
| 2007 | -8.7% | TL-7.40 Million | TL84.62 Million | TL92.02 Million | ▼ -0.6 pp |
| 2006 | -8.2% | TL-7.06 Million | TL86.54 Million | TL93.61 Million | ▼ -11.9 pp |
| 2005 | 3.7% | TL3.32 Million | TL88.54 Million | TL85.22 Million | — |
